Q: What type of church is Mount Helena?
A: Mount Helena Community Church is a contemporary, Biblical church communicating the Bible in a creative, compelling, and relevant way. The life and heart of MHCC can be summed up in a single phrase: Lifting Others Up! That’s our vision, our motto, our passion.

We want to assist people in their search for God and to build a real community of people committed to one another and to God. The people of Mount Helena are also passionate about being involved in and serving their local community and putting the Words of Jesus into action.

We are a non-denominational, independent church, which means:

  • We choose our own staff.
  • We own our building and assets.
  • We determine our ministries and programs.
  • We select our missionaries and the outreach programs to support.

However, even though we are an independent church, we believe in the importance of relationship and accountability, which is why Mount Helena Community Church belongs to LifeLinks. LifeLinks provides oversight and enables us to form strong, intentional relationships with other like-minded churches. In addition, we also have many close relationships with other churches in the Helena area.
